Understanding 4A Molecular Sieve Powder: Applications and Benefits in Chemical Industry


4A Molecular Sieve Powder is a highly porous material that belongs to the family of zeolites, specifically designed for molecular adsorption and separation processes. Its unique crystalline structure allows it to selectively adsorb molecules based on size, making it an essential component in various industrial applications, particularly in the chemical sector focused on drying agents and adsorbents.
One of the primary characteristics of 4A Molecular Sieve Powder is its ability to adsorb water molecules effectively. Its pore size of approximately 4 angstroms allows it to trap water while excluding larger molecules, making it ideal for dehydrating gases and liquids. This property is particularly beneficial in industries where moisture control is crucial, such as pharmaceuticals, petrochemicals, and food processing. By keeping products moisture-free, manufacturers can enhance product stability and extend shelf life.
In addition to moisture removal, 4A Molecular Sieve Powder is also utilized in gas purification processes. It can adsorb various impurities, including carbon dioxide, hydrogen sulfide, and organic compounds, thus improving the quality of gases used in different applications. This makes it an invaluable resource in the production of high-purity gases, which are essential in semiconductor manufacturing and other high-tech industries.
Moreover, the use of 4A Molecular Sieve Powder can lead to significant operational efficiencies. By integrating it into existing processes, companies can reduce energy consumption associated with drying and purification operations. The high adsorption capacity of 4A Molecular Sieve Powder ensures that less material is needed compared to conventional drying agents, resulting in cost savings and reduced environmental impact.
When considering the application of 4A Molecular Sieve Powder, it is important to evaluate the specific requirements of the process. Factors such as temperature, pressure, and the nature of the substances being processed can influence the effectiveness of the molecular sieve. Therefore, conducting thorough evaluations and tests is essential to optimize the performance of 4A Molecular Sieve Powder in any industrial application.
